Re: startx doesn't run proprely


On 6/24/2010 11:58 PM, hakobyan@ualberta.ca wrote:
Dear Cygwin helper,

After the "startx" command it doesn't open X terminal. In fact, it
sometimes open Xterm sometimes not, givin the following error message:

Welcom to the XWin X Server
Vendor: The Cygwin/X Project
Release: 6.8.99.901-4
^^^^^^^^^^^^

Please, tell me what to do to get rid of the problem?

Try upgrading from this very old, monolithic X server to the current version. Don't forget to check the announcement for details and helpful hints about this upgrade.
